The Swiss legal frame for fiduciary services
Responsibility for the books is personal: in an SA, organising the accounting is one of the board's non-transferable duties (art. 716a CO); in a Sàrl, the managing directors carry the same duty. Outsourcing the execution never transfers that underlying responsibility, including for a company based in Muralto.

Year-end closing: how the mechanics work
The income statement reads as a cascade: gross margin, operating result, financial result, extraordinary result. Each level answers a different question — mixing levels blurs the steering.
For fiduciary services, the golden rule is to discover nothing in January: every uncertainty (doubtful receivable, dispute, unsellable stock) must be identified before the closing date, not after.

What are the legal obligations for fiduciary services in Switzerland?
The foundation is the Code of Obligations: proper bookkeeping (art. 957a CO), annual accounts (balance sheet, income statement, notes) and 10-year retention of books and records (art. 958f CO). VAT applies from CHF 100,000 of turnover, and social insurance settlements from the first employee. Nothing is different in Muralto: federal law applies.
What is the difference between a limited and an ordinary audit?
The ordinary audit applies to companies exceeding, for two consecutive years, two of three thresholds: CHF 20 million balance sheet total, CHF 40 million revenue, 250 full-time positions. Others fall under the limited audit, and those with no more than ten full-time positions on annual average can opt out with all shareholders' consent. These federal thresholds do not depend on the registered seat — in Muralto as anywhere.

What are the current Swiss VAT rates?
Since 1 January 2024: 8.1% (standard), 2.6% (reduced — for example food and medicines) and 3.8% (accommodation). Returns must be filed and paid within 60 days after the period ends (quarterly under the effective method, semi-annually under the net tax rate method). These federal rates apply unchanged in Muralto.
